Debian DSA-1058-1 : awstats - missing input sanitising

medium Nessus Plugin ID 22600

Synopsis

The remote Debian host is missing a security-related update.

Description

Hendrik Weimer discovered that specially crafted web requests can cause awstats, a powerful and featureful web server log analyzer, to execute arbitrary commands.

Solution

Upgrade the awstats package.

The old stable distribution (woody) is not affected by this problem.

For the stable distribution (sarge) this problem has been fixed in version 6.4-1sarge2.
